IMO: 1157226|
China
CHANG JIANG SU HANG (IMO: 1157226) is a Other. CHANG JIANG SU HANG vessel length overall (LOA) is nullm, beam is nullm.
CHANG JIANG SU HANG (IMO: 1157226) is a Other. CHANG JIANG SU HANG vessel length overall (LOA) is nullm, beam is nullm.